About Converting Nanograms per Cubic Centimeter to Troy ounces per Cubic Centimeter
Nanogram per Cubic Centimeter and Troy ounce per Cubic Centimeter both measure density — mass per unit volume — a property used to identify materials, check manufacturing quality, and predict whether something floats or sinks. As a fixed reference point, water has a density of exactly 1000 kg/m³ (1 g/cm³, 1 g/mL) at its temperature of maximum density, which is why many density figures in science and engineering are quoted relative to water. Both are mass per volume density units.
Formula
troy ounces per cubic centimeter = nanograms per cubic centimeter × 3.215075e-11
This factor comes from each unit's defined relationship to the category's base unit: 1 nanogram per cubic centimeter equals 0.000001 base units, and 1 troy ounce per cubic centimeter equals 31103.4768 base units, so dividing one by the other gives the direct nanogram per cubic centimeter-to-troy ounce per cubic centimeter factor of 3.215075e-11.

What's the difference between density and mass concentration?
Density is the mass of a pure substance or material per unit volume. Mass concentration is the mass of one component — like a dissolved solute — within a mixture's total volume. The two use the same kind of units but describe different physical situations.
